Triobol
| Issuer | Arpi |
| Year | 215 BC - 212 BC |
| Type | Standard circulation coin |
| Value | Triobol (1/2) |
| Currency | Drachm |
| Composition | Silver |
| Weight | 1.90 g |
| Dimensions | 15 mm |
| Thickness | |
| Shape and Technique | Round (irregular) Hammered |
| Orientation | |
| Engraver(s) | |
| In circulation to | |
| Reference(s) | HN Italy#646, SNG Copenhagen#601 |
| Obverse description | Helmeted head of Athena left. |
| Obverse script | |
| Obverse lettering | |
| Reverse description | Three grain ears conjoined at the stem. |
| Reverse script | Greek |
| Reverse lettering | ΑΡ
ΠΑ |
